Weather in Hyderabad may continue to fluctuate as India Meteorological Department on Friday (April 18, 2025) has forecast light to moderate rain or thundershowers accompanied with gusty winds (30-40 kmph) very likely in the city and its neighbourhood over the next 24 hours. The city which experienced hot temperatures, also received rains, gusty winds this week.

The IMD has been issued a yellow alert to 16 districts for Saturday (April 19, 2025). Thunderstorm ACCOMPANIED WITH LIGHTNING AND GUTTY WINDS WINDS Sangareddy, Medak, Mahabubnagar, Nagarkurnool, Wanaparthy, Narayanpet and Jogulamba Gadwal. Ranging from 41 ° C to 44 ° C.

Temperatures in 11 districts on Saturday may range from 41°C to 44°C, according to  India Meteorological Department.

According to its maximum temperature report, the highest temperature on Thursday was recorded in Nizamabad (42°C), followed by Adilabad (41.8°C) and Medak (41.2°C).
